Crockpot Green Bean Casserole

about the recipe

Make your holidays easier with this Crockpot Green Bean Casserole!  Made from fresh green beans, savory mushrooms, and crispy fried onions, this dish strikes a nice balance between rich and flavorful. It’s a fun take on classic green bean casserole that frees up oven space without sacrificing flavor.

INGREDIENTS

– 2 pounds fresh green beans trimmed and cut into 1” pieces – 2 tablespoons unsalted butter – 1 pound white mushrooms sliced – 1 onion sliced thin – ¼ cup all-purpose flour or gluten-free – 1 teaspoon sea salt – ¼ teaspoon freshly ground black pepper – ⅛ teaspoon cayenne pepper – 2 cups chicken broth – 2 ½ cups half and half – 1 cup shredded Gruyere cheese – 1 ½ cups fried onions about 3 ounces

– Place the green beans in the bottom of your slow cooker.

– Melt the butter in a large saute pan over medium-high heat.  Add the mushrooms and cook for 5 minutes.  Add the onions and cook for another 5 minutes.  Sprinkle with the flour, salt, pepper, and cayenne pepper.

– Cook for 1 minute.  Stir in the broth, a little at a time.  Bring to a simmer, and then whisk in the half and half.  Reduce to medium-low, and cook for 10 minutes, until the sauce is thick.

– Pour the sauce over the green beans, and top with the cheese.

– Cover and cook over low heat for 4 to 6 hours.

– Top with the fried onions just before serving.
